Creating a New Combined

Wire from a Selected Set of Wires for a Combined Signal

You can combine a set of combinable wires for a combined signal to create a new combined wire that multiple signals can use.

Procedure

In the Design Browser (Design tab), right-click the combined signal and choose Combine > Wires > [Combinable Set of Wires].

Results

The individual wires are removed and a combined wire is added below the combined signal to which the wires belong in the Design Browser (Design tab).
